如何解决swagger界面中的basic-error-controller

本文档指导如何在SpringBoot 2.5.7应用中启用Swagger-BootstrapUI,以创建和展示RESTful API文档。通过将@EnableSwagger2改为@EnableSwagger2Doc,并配置相关依赖及yml设置,可以访问/doc.html查看美化后的API文档。步骤包括修改启动类、添加POM依赖和配置YML文件,最后展示了配置成功后的效果。

最有效解决方法

  1. 检查你的启动类(xxxAplication.java)
  2. @EnableSwagger2改成@EnableSwagger2Doc
  3. 访问路径:端口后面添加/doc.html。例如:http://localhost:8033/doc.html

全部看完,再感谢我,如果跟你的有区别那就继续百度…

pom.xml

		<!--Swagger-BootstrapUI-->
        <dependency>
            <groupId>io.springfox</groupId>
            <artifactId>springfox-swagger2</artifactId>
            <version>2.9.2</version>
        </dependency>
        <dependency>
            <groupId>com.github.xiaoymin</groupId>
            <artifactId>swagger-bootstrap-ui</artifactId>
            <version>1.9.6</version>
        </dependency>
        <dependency>
            <groupId>com.spring4all</groupId>
            <artifactId>swagger-spring-boot-starter</artifactId>
            <version>1.9.0.RELEASE</version>
        </dependency>

yml

swagger:
  enabled: true
  title: 标题
  version: 版本
  description: 描述
  base-package: 基础路径(*重要*)
  #作者
  contact:
    name: Az
    email: azt0903@163.com

我用的是Swagger-BootstrapUI,springboot版本2.5.7。
效果图如下:
在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值